One of the best ways to experience the rich tapestry of flavors in Singapore is by visiting the city’s many street food markets.
These markets offer a wide range of dishes, from the iconic Hainanese chicken rice to the flavorful laksa and delicious satay. Some popular street food markets to visit include Maxwell Food Centre, Lau Pa Sat satay street, Newton Food Centre, and Tiong Bahru Market. These markets not only offer a chance to sample some of the best hawker food in Singapore but also provide a glimpse into the local culture and way of life.
